Array Formulas in Microsoft Excel, a powerful feature that allows users to perform complex calculations and manipulate data sets with efficiency, are a versatile tool integral to advanced spreadsheet functionalities. The application of Array Formulas involves a unique syntax and methodology, providing users with a dynamic means to process data beyond the capabilities of standard formulas.
To employ Array Formulas effectively, one must comprehend their distinctive structure and the manner in which they interact with arrays, which are sets of values or data ranges. Unlike conventional formulas that operate on individual cells, Array Formulas process multiple values simultaneously, offering a more streamlined approach to data analysis and manipulation.
The syntax for an Array Formula typically involves entering the formula and confirming it with Ctrl+Shift+Enter, as opposed to the usual Enter key. This distinction is critical, as it signals Excel to treat the formula as an array function, enabling it to work with arrays of data.
One of the fundamental applications of Array Formulas lies in performing calculations across entire ranges of data without the need for explicit cell references. For instance, if one wishes to calculate the sum of the products of corresponding values in two arrays, the standard formula would necessitate individual multiplication and addition functions. In contrast, an Array Formula simplifies this process by applying a single formula to the entire range, significantly enhancing efficiency and reducing the likelihood of errors.
Nested within the realm of Array Formulas is the concept of array constants, which are static arrays defined within the formula itself. These constants provide a convenient means to manipulate data without the requirement of a dedicated range in the worksheet. This flexibility contributes to the versatility of Array Formulas, empowering users to perform intricate calculations with ease.
Furthermore, Array Formulas prove invaluable when dealing with multi-dimensional arrays, facilitating operations on tables of data organized in rows and columns. By seamlessly processing these arrays, users can extract meaningful insights and perform advanced analyses without resorting to complex and convoluted formulas.
A noteworthy application of Array Formulas involves the use of conditional logic within arrays, enabling users to apply criteria to data sets and obtain results based on specific conditions. This feature enhances the ability to filter and extract relevant information from large datasets, contributing to a more targeted and efficient data analysis process.
Moreover, Array Formulas can be employed to transpose data, converting rows into columns and vice versa. This capability is particularly beneficial when reorganizing data for presentation or analysis purposes, offering a convenient solution to reshape information without the need for manual adjustments.
In addition to these foundational aspects, Array Formulas also support the use of various functions that are specifically designed to operate on arrays. These functions include SUMPRODUCT, MMULT, TRANSPOSE, and more, each catering to specific array manipulation requirements. Leveraging these functions in conjunction with Array Formulas amplifies their utility and opens avenues for intricate data processing tasks.
It is imperative for users to grasp the nuances of referencing and manipulating arrays within Array Formulas to harness their full potential. Understanding array syntax, including the use of commas to separate values and semicolons to denote different rows, is pivotal for crafting accurate and effective formulas. This comprehension empowers users to navigate and manipulate arrays seamlessly, ensuring precise and reliable outcomes.
In conclusion, the utilization of Array Formulas in Microsoft Excel transcends conventional spreadsheet functionalities, providing users with a potent toolset for advanced data analysis and manipulation. Through their unique syntax, support for array constants, and compatibility with various array functions, Array Formulas empower users to streamline complex calculations, apply conditional logic to datasets, and manipulate arrays with unparalleled efficiency. As users delve into the intricacies of Array Formulas, they unlock a realm of possibilities, transforming their Excel experience and enhancing their ability to extract valuable insights from data.
More Informations
Delving deeper into the realm of Array Formulas in Microsoft Excel, it becomes evident that their utility extends far beyond basic arithmetic operations. These formulas serve as a dynamic bridge between traditional cell-based computations and the more advanced requirements of complex data analysis. As users navigate the intricacies of Array Formulas, they uncover a plethora of features that contribute to their versatility and efficacy.
Array Formulas facilitate the aggregation of data from multiple sources, allowing users to consolidate information seamlessly. This is particularly advantageous when dealing with datasets distributed across various worksheets or workbooks. By leveraging Array Formulas, users can aggregate, analyze, and manipulate data from disparate locations, streamlining the process of deriving comprehensive insights from diverse sources.
Furthermore, the concept of array functions within Array Formulas opens doors to sophisticated statistical analyses. Users can employ functions like FREQUENCY, MODE, and MEDIAN to gain a deeper understanding of the distribution and characteristics of their data. This capability is especially valuable in scenarios where a detailed examination of datasets is crucial for informed decision-making.
Array Formulas also play a pivotal role in dynamic data validation. Traditional data validation in Excel typically involves setting criteria for individual cells. However, Array Formulas enable users to apply dynamic criteria to entire ranges of data, allowing for real-time validation and adjustment as the underlying data changes. This feature is particularly beneficial in scenarios where maintaining data integrity is paramount.
Moreover, the integration of Array Formulas with conditional formatting unleashes a new dimension of visual data analysis. Users can apply complex conditions to arrays of data, and the formatting changes dynamically based on the satisfaction of these conditions. This not only enhances the visual representation of data but also provides an intuitive way to identify patterns and anomalies within large datasets.
Another noteworthy facet of Array Formulas lies in their compatibility with database functions, offering users a powerful means to query and analyze data without resorting to external database tools. By combining Array Formulas with functions like DSUM, DMAX, and DMIN, users can create sophisticated queries within Excel, eliminating the need for complex database management systems in certain scenarios.
Additionally, Array Formulas can be utilized in conjunction with dynamic arrays, a feature introduced in recent Excel versions. Dynamic arrays enable the spill functionality, where results automatically spill over multiple cells based on the size of the output. When combined with Array Formulas, dynamic arrays enhance the efficiency of calculations, providing a seamless and dynamic way to handle changing datasets.
The concept of array constants within Array Formulas also extends to the creation of dynamic charts and visualizations. By embedding array constants directly within formulas that generate chart data, users can create dynamic visual representations that automatically update as underlying data changes. This not only simplifies the chart creation process but also ensures that visualizations stay current and reflective of the latest data.
Furthermore, Array Formulas shine in scenarios where users need to extract unique values or distinct records from a dataset. By incorporating functions like INDEX, MATCH, and UNIQUE within Array Formulas, users can efficiently retrieve unique values based on specific criteria, facilitating a more nuanced exploration of data subsets.
As users navigate the landscape of Array Formulas, it becomes evident that their impact extends to diverse domains, including finance, engineering, and scientific research. For financial analysts, Array Formulas offer a robust toolkit for scenarios like cash flow modeling, scenario analysis, and portfolio optimization. Engineers can leverage Array Formulas to perform intricate calculations in areas such as structural analysis and simulation. In scientific research, Array Formulas prove invaluable for data manipulation and statistical analysis, enabling researchers to derive meaningful conclusions from experimental results.
In conclusion, the versatility and depth of Array Formulas in Microsoft Excel empower users to transcend conventional spreadsheet limitations. From consolidating data across multiple sources to conducting advanced statistical analyses, Array Formulas serve as a catalyst for enhanced data manipulation and analysis. Their compatibility with various Excel features, including dynamic arrays, conditional formatting, and database functions, positions them as a cornerstone for efficient and dynamic data processing. As users continue to explore and integrate Array Formulas into their Excel workflows, they unlock a realm of possibilities that significantly elevate their ability to extract valuable insights and make informed decisions.
Keywords
Certainly, let’s delve into the key words presented in the article and provide a detailed explanation and interpretation for each:
-
Array Formulas:
- Explanation: Array Formulas in Microsoft Excel are special formulas that enable users to perform complex calculations on arrays of data rather than individual cells. They are entered using a unique syntax and often involve processing multiple values simultaneously.
- Interpretation: Array Formulas are a powerful tool for advanced data manipulation, allowing users to streamline calculations, analyze large datasets, and perform operations on arrays efficiently.
-
Syntax:
- Explanation: Syntax refers to the set of rules that dictate how words and symbols should be combined to form valid expressions or commands in a programming language or, in this case, Excel formulas.
- Interpretation: Understanding the syntax of Array Formulas is crucial for users to correctly input and execute these formulas. It involves using specific symbols and conventions to ensure the formula is processed as an array function.
-
Ctrl+Shift+Enter:
- Explanation: This key combination is used to confirm and execute an Array Formula in Excel. Unlike regular formulas that are entered with the Enter key, Array Formulas require Ctrl+Shift+Enter to signal Excel to treat them as array functions.
- Interpretation: The use of Ctrl+Shift+Enter distinguishes Array Formulas from standard formulas and is essential for activating their array processing capabilities.
-
Array Constants:
- Explanation: Array constants are static arrays defined within a formula, eliminating the need for a dedicated range in the worksheet. They provide a means to manipulate data directly within the formula.
- Interpretation: Array constants enhance the flexibility of Array Formulas, allowing users to perform calculations without explicitly referencing ranges in the spreadsheet.
-
Multi-dimensional Arrays:
- Explanation: Multi-dimensional arrays in Excel involve organizing data in tables with rows and columns. Array Formulas can efficiently operate on these arrays, enabling users to analyze and manipulate data structured in two dimensions.
- Interpretation: Multi-dimensional arrays facilitate the representation and analysis of complex datasets, and Array Formulas provide a streamlined approach to work with such data structures.
-
Conditional Logic:
- Explanation: Conditional logic involves applying criteria to data based on specified conditions. In the context of Array Formulas, it allows users to filter and extract relevant information from arrays.
- Interpretation: Conditional logic enhances the precision of data analysis, enabling users to focus on specific subsets of data that meet certain criteria.
-
Transpose:
- Explanation: Transpose is a function in Excel that converts rows into columns and vice versa. Array Formulas can be used to transpose data efficiently.
- Interpretation: The ability to transpose data is valuable for reshaping information, and Array Formulas provide a convenient solution for this transformation.
-
Array Functions:
- Explanation: Array functions are specialized functions designed to operate on arrays of data. Examples include SUMPRODUCT, MMULT, and TRANSPOSE.
- Interpretation: Integrating Array Formulas with array functions enhances their utility, offering users a diverse set of tools for complex data manipulation tasks.
-
Dynamic Arrays:
- Explanation: Dynamic arrays, introduced in recent Excel versions, allow formulas to spill over multiple cells dynamically based on the size of the output. When combined with Array Formulas, they enhance the efficiency of calculations.
- Interpretation: Dynamic arrays provide a seamless and dynamic approach to handling changing datasets, particularly beneficial when working with evolving or dynamic data.
-
Data Validation:
- Explanation: Data validation involves setting criteria to ensure data integrity. Array Formulas extend data validation by allowing users to apply dynamic criteria to entire ranges of data.
- Interpretation: Array Formulas contribute to maintaining data integrity by providing a robust mechanism for real-time validation and adjustment as data changes.
-
Conditional Formatting:
- Explanation: Conditional formatting allows users to apply formatting changes to cells based on specified conditions. Array Formulas can be integrated with conditional formatting for dynamic visual data analysis.
- Interpretation: By combining Array Formulas with conditional formatting, users can create visualizations that dynamically respond to changes in underlying data, aiding in the identification of patterns and anomalies.
-
Database Functions:
- Explanation: Database functions in Excel, such as DSUM, DMAX, and DMIN, are designed to perform queries and analyses on data. Array Formulas can be combined with these functions to create sophisticated queries within Excel.
- Interpretation: The integration of Array Formulas with database functions provides a powerful means to query and analyze data directly within Excel, eliminating the need for external database tools in certain scenarios.
-
Dynamic Charts:
- Explanation: Dynamic charts in Excel automatically update based on changes in underlying data. Array Formulas can be employed to create dynamic chart data, ensuring that visualizations stay current.
- Interpretation: Array Formulas enhance the creation of dynamic charts, allowing users to generate visual representations that adapt to changes in the dataset, providing real-time insights.
-
Unique Values:
- Explanation: Unique values refer to distinct records within a dataset. Array Formulas, with functions like INDEX, MATCH, and UNIQUE, facilitate the extraction of unique values based on specific criteria.
- Interpretation: Array Formulas empower users to efficiently retrieve and analyze unique values, contributing to a more nuanced exploration of subsets within large datasets.
-
Financial Analysis, Engineering, Scientific Research:
- Explanation: These terms highlight the diverse applications of Array Formulas across various domains. In financial analysis, engineers, and scientific research, Array Formulas play a crucial role in tasks such as cash flow modeling, structural analysis, simulation, and statistical analysis.
- Interpretation: Array Formulas are not limited to specific industries; their versatility makes them indispensable across diverse sectors, empowering users in different fields to perform complex calculations and analyses efficiently.
In summary, these key terms encompass the foundational concepts and applications of Array Formulas in Microsoft Excel, shedding light on their significance in data manipulation, analysis, and visualization across diverse scenarios and industries.